> Eli> Please don't use @tindex, we don't use such an index in the GDB
> Eli> manual.
> 
> Now that we have documentation describing types, it seems like we
> ought to add a type index.

What's wrong with having them documented in the main index?  We can
always have something like

  @cindex @code{Foo}, a data type

More than one index in a manual complicates looking up things, and I
don't feel the number of types we have in GDB, or will have in the
near future, justifies this inconveniency.  But I'm open to arguments
to the contrary.
